I installed the GMC Chrome All-Terrain grille today on my 2008 GMC Sierra and couldn't be happier with it. I wanted a chrome grille but didn't want an aftermarket grille that I would have to worry about fit and finish with so I went with the Genuine GM grille. back when I purchased my truck I originally wanted one with the All-Terrain package but the dealer didn't have a steel grey model in stock so I settled for the SLT with the factory 20's. I kick myself in the ars for not waiting for a steel grey All-Terrain to come in but it's too late now right!!! The All-Terrain grille is all chrome and has four cross bars instead of just the three, it came with the GMC emblems already installed and was a direct replacement.

 

GM All-Terrain Grille Part Number 25809578

GM list is $415

My GM Employee cost was only $251

 

Installation was pretty simple.

1) Open hood and remove the 8 plastic clips from the black radiator cover above the grille.

 

2) Remove the four 10mm screws from the top of the grille.

 

3) Remove the four 7mm screws (two on each side) from the painted plastic body filler under the grille. screws are located at the wheel well openings. be careful/gentle - after the screws are removed it's just held in by clips and the tabs which you can see by looking behind the grille from above.

 

4) Use a pair of pliers to squeeze the holding tabs of the metal clips which are used to secure the grille to the radiator support. Remove grille and set aside.

 

5) Install new Grille with clips only.

 

6) Install filler panel.

 

7) Install the four 10mm screws but don't tighten!!!

 

8) Install the black radiator cover with the rear retaining clips, align the front holes with the openings in the new grille then tighten the four 10mm screws then install the front retaining clips in the radiator cover.

When a barrel comes out of the ground the entire range of products are present but not all at the same percentage.    Breakdown of Refined Products The following table summarizes the approximate output from a standard 42-gallon barrel of crude oil: Product Type Gallons per Barrel Percentage of Total Gasoline 20 gallons 45% Diesel Fuel 9 gallons 21% Other Products 13 gallons 31%   Most of that diesel figure is 'straight run' or cut from the barrel. Gasoline 'cut from the barrel runs 0 to 20% at the crude. So in the crude unit there is more diesel the gasoline, usually.  The full refining experience however gives the tabled values. Ego there is half the diesel than gasoline after the 'first crack' That could be an FCC unit, or Isomax or....   Those units take heavy products and break the big ones into little ones. Those numbers are harder to get hold of but directionally it ends up the same.    Really light products are very profitable. Ethylene and Propylene to name two. Those are cracked from slightly heavier feeds like NG and Propane and Ethane. The cracker harshness determines the feed for distillation. Those feeds come from less profitable products like diesel and gasoline.    So...there is a swap cost. How much market is there TODAY and what crude am I running TODAY..... what is my process capable of always.    There is this as well. The USA uses allot more gasoline than it does diesel so in the cracker the process is tilted to gasoline production which....limits supply of diesel. OTR uses the most and it has different requirements than automotive and agricultural.  Limiting auto products.    You are correct however. It is less refined, just less of it. Allot less. 
    • Most thermostatically controlled ATF systems use a 'wax' pill just like the one in your water thermostat. They work on the expansion volume of the wax and the pill is constructed in such a way as to limit the travel to remain within that range. This means it has an opening temperature often called the 'cracking temperature' and a fully open temperature. For whatever reason oil is designated by it's fully open temperature and water by it's cracking temperature.    Between the two it the "Regulating Temperature" The entire range is about 20 F from closed to open. In your example the lower limit, opening point of 145 F then has a fully open temp of 165 F and a throttling temperature of 155 F.    Thing is, the throttling temperature needs two things to work properly. Enough system load high enough to reach the minimum and a heat sink (cooler/exchanger) large enough to prevent any load applied from exceeding the fully open temperature.    If your system exceeds the fully open temperature it is screaming MORE COOLER.    Here is the silly part of the whole thermostat system where the oil is cooled/heated by the radiator. Nothing is flowing to that system until the oil temperature reaches the cracking temperature unless it is equipped with a minimum flow bypass orifice or a bypass built into the seating surface of the plunger. That system meant to get it up to temp quicker isn't doing a thing until WORK drives if from ambient to cracking temp. One a cold winter day, like zero F, it may never get hotter than about 110 F. Sometimes not even that.    People forget or are young enough to not know that until this millennia transmissions were cooled by the radiator cold tank alone and without a thermostat at all.  In the 50's they weren't even cooled. OEMs learn everything the hard way.    When an OEM tells you the trans "Works best" between 175 F and 220 F it means works best for THEM. The transmission thermostat is fuel play. If you watch you trans temps like I do you will learn that it may take a hundred miles if you are not towing and not driving more than say 55-60 mph on a zero F day to even reach 120 F and it might sit there all day if it's colder. Yet if functions perfectly over about 100 F. It may need to get a bit warmer for the fuel and spark maps to go without an multiplier.    Worry more about too hot. Use a cooler large enough to put that thermostat in range.
